linux自動退出
『壹』 linux伺服器中由於內存不足導致tomcat自動關閉解決方案
伺服器環境:
騰訊雲1核2G
操作系統蠢帶首:CentOS7
最近將項目部署到伺服器後發現tomcat總是過一段時間會自動關掉。
查看系統日誌
發現如下內容:
原因分析:linux會定時檢查系統內存大小,發現剩餘內存過小時會自動優先清理佔用內存較大的進程,因此tomcat進程經常會被系統清除掉
(1)創建腳本文件tomcatMonitor.sh
(2)對腳本文件授權
(行帆3)將腳本文件加入到定時任務中
添加如下內容
保存並退出
(如果出現以下內容,則輸入3進入vim編輯模式再進行編輯)
具體crontab命令參考: https://www.cnblogs.com/zoulongbin/p/6187238.html
(4)查看任務執行情況
輸出如下內容表示定時任務正在執行
參考博客帶數:
https://www.cnblogs.com/zoulongbin/p/6187238.html
https://blog.csdn.net/zhang41228/article/details/79860030
『貳』 linux解壓一半窗口閃退了
方法一:
1、使用win+r組合鍵打開命令提示符窗口,右鍵點擊窗戶標題欄,選擇屬性,打開如圖窗口:
2、把「使用舊版控螞蘆制台」前面的鉤去掉。重新啟動即可。
方法二:
使用方法一時,偶爾會發現「使用舊版控制台」選項並未選中,此時可以採用另外一種方法。
通過win+r組合悶沒帶鍵打開命令提示符窗口,輸入或復制粘貼命令:C:\windows\system32\bash.exe,並執行即可調出bash窗口。
第一次打開bash窗口,如圖,輸入察陸y下載即可。
『叄』 為什麼Linux里root模式下輸入login自動退出超級終端
man login後可以看到下面的解釋
If the user is root, then the login must be occurring on a tty listed in /etc/securetty. Failures will be logged with the syslog facility.
大意是:如果當前用戶是root用戶,login程序會觸發/etc/securetty的tty安全機制(即不再/etc/securetty內的終端類型不予以登錄),一般默認在securetty內的是vc/……或者tty……,而你w或who一下可以看到自己是pts下,所以會自動退出。
『肆』 Linux系統輸入超時,自動退出登錄
對所有用戶設置自動注銷功能:
首先,以root用戶登錄系統,輸入 vi /etc/profile 命令,編輯profile文件。
查找TMOUT,若沒有,則可以在文件最後添加如下語句:
TMOUT=300
export TOMOUT
如果查找到了,直接設置時間。
300表示自動注銷的時間為300秒。
編輯好文件後,保存,退出,重新登錄,設置生效。